How Does Comfort Systems USA Drive Its Growth?

In 2024, Comfort Systems USA unified its regional brands under a 'Total Building Solutions' campaign. This pivotal shift transformed the company from a decentralized network into a cohesive, nationally recognized enterprise. The strategy directly fueled a 17.3% revenue surge to $5.89 billion.

How Does Comfort Systems Reach Its Customers?

Comfort Systems USA employs a hybrid sales channel model that strategically balances a localized direct sales force with a centralized national accounts team. This approach effectively captures both regional project work and large-scale enterprise contracts, driving significant revenue growth.

Icon Local Operating Units

An extensive network of over 115 local units across 143 cities forms the core of its sales and marketing strategy. These decentralized teams, staffed with project managers and sales engineers, cultivate deep relationships with local contractors and building owners.

Icon National Accounts Division

This centralized team focuses on securing multi-site, multi-year agreements with Fortune 500 clients. Established in 2021, it now contributes over $1.2 billion in annual contract value from sectors like data centers and healthcare.

Icon Digital Platform: Comfort 360

The proprietary 'Comfort 360' platform serves as a powerful digital marketing channel and service delivery tool. It has been instrumental in facilitating over 38% of all new preventive maintenance agreements in 2024, enhancing customer retention.

Icon Strategic Vendor Partnerships

The company maintains exclusive partnerships with building automation giants like Siemens and Johnson Controls. These alliances allow it to offer fully integrated control solutions, a key part of its value proposition and competitive strategy.

Icon

Strategic Impact & Performance

This evolved omnichannel strategy has driven remarkable financial results, moving beyond a purely acquisition-driven local model. The hybrid approach has been instrumental in increasing service segment revenue by 24% in 2024 and securing a record $3.1 billion backlog.

  • Local units generate an estimated 65% of its $5.89 billion annual revenue
  • Focuses on design-build bids and local service contracts
  • Represents a sophisticated blend of B2B sales tactics
  • Directly supports the broader Marketing Strategy of Comfort Systems

What Marketing Tactics Does Comfort Systems Use?

Comfort Systems USA deploys a sophisticated marketing strategy centered on high-value Account-Based Marketing and technical thought leadership, tailored for the complex B2B sales cycle of major construction projects. Its data-driven tactics leverage a proprietary customer data platform and a robust content engine, generating an estimated 1,200 high-quality leads per quarter from over 50,000 monthly resource center visitors.

Icon

Content Marketing Engine

The cornerstone of the HVAC marketing approach is a resource center producing in-depth white papers, case studies, and webinars. This content focuses on emerging trends like data center cooling and building electrification to drive lead generation.

Icon

Hyper-Personalized Nurturing

A proprietary CDP segments audiences across over a dozen verticals for targeted communications. This enables email campaigns that achieve a 32% open rate, significantly boosting customer retention.

Icon

Digital Advertising Focus

Digital tactics include targeted LinkedIn ads for key decision-makers and strategic paid search for high-intent keywords. Over 68% of the marketing budget is allocated to these digital initiatives as of FY2024.

Icon

Innovative VR Demonstrations

The company uses virtual reality for pre-construction planning, allowing clients to visualize complex MEP systems. This innovative tactic has improved close rates on design-build proposals by an estimated 15%.

Icon

Integrated Marketing Communications

The strategy blends digital campaigns with select traditional trade publication ads. This ensures comprehensive market coverage and supports the overall brand positioning strategy.

Icon

Data-Driven Audience Segmentation

The CDP is central to understanding the target audience and personalizing the value proposition. This data-centric approach is fundamental to its customer acquisition and business development success.

Icon

Strategic Marketing Allocation

The marketing plan for this service industry leader reflects a decisive shift toward measurable, performance-based channels. This focus on digital and content-driven initiatives directly supports revenue growth and provides a significant competitive advantage. How Is Comfort Systems Positioned in the Market?

Comfort Systems USA has meticulously crafted its brand positioning as the nation's most reliable and technically advanced provider of comprehensive building solutions. This strategy effectively differentiates the company by leveraging a powerful combination of national resources and local execution, targeting key decision-makers with a core message of 'Engineering Comfort, Powering Performance'.

Icon Core Brand Message

The company's core brand message, 'Engineering Comfort, Powering Performance,' communicates a dual promise of occupant well-being and operational excellence. This messaging specifically targets chief engineers, property managers, and corporate sustainability officers.

Icon Visual Identity and Tone

The visual identity and tone of voice are professional, clean, and engineering-focused, emphasizing trust, precision, and long-term partnership. This approach moves beyond low-cost transactions to build lasting client relationships.

Icon Unique Selling Proposition

Its unique selling proposition is the ability to leverage a vast national portfolio of project experience and purchasing power to deliver innovation and cost savings. Local teams ensure personalized service and rapid response times, creating a powerful competitive advantage.

Icon Sustainability Focus

The brand positioning is powerfully supported by its focus on ESG and sustainability, with a 2024 pledge to achieve net-zero emissions across its fleet and operations by 2040. This serves as a key differentiator for clients facing their own sustainability mandates.

Icon

Brand Management and Results

Brand consistency is managed through a centralized marketing enablement platform providing all local units with approved templates, messaging, and case studies. This disciplined approach to brand positioning has yielded significant measurable results for the company.

  • The company ranked #1 in 'Most Preferred Mechanical Contractor' in a 2024 industry survey by Building Design+Construction
  • Reports a 12% premium on project bids where the corporate brand is the lead differentiator
  • Ensures a cohesive brand experience from a national RFP response to a local service technician's arrival

What Are Comfort Systems’s Most Notable Campaigns?

Comfort Systems USA employs a sophisticated B2B sales and marketing strategy centered on high-value, integrated solutions. Their key campaigns demonstrate a powerful shift from generic HVAC advertising to project-specific thought leadership, directly fueling the company's impressive revenue growth and market positioning.

Icon Total Building Solutions (2024)

This flagship campaign integrated HVAC, electrical, and automation services under 'One Call. One Partner. Infinite Solutions.' It generated over 15 million impressions and drove a 22% increase in cross-service contract wins within the first nine months of 2024.

Icon Data Center Dive (2023)

A targeted Account-Based Marketing program secured three major contracts worth over $450 million. It positioned the company as an expert through technical workshops co-hosted with chip manufacturers on advanced cooling technologies.

Icon 360 Service Digital Campaign

This ongoing digital effort for the integrated building management platform utilizes retargeting and a free system health-check offer. It achieved an 18% conversion rate, adding over $150 million in annual recurring revenue to the service backlog in 2024.

Icon Strategic Channel Deployment

The marketing plan leverages a mix of LinkedIn, targeted digital ads, high-impact trade shows, and direct outreach to C-suite executives. This multi-channel approach ensures maximum reach within their specific target audience for commercial contracts.
